Evelyn Davis reflects on a century of living Downeast

by Sarah Craighead Dedmon

It was standing room only when family and friends gathered to celebrate Evelyn Watts Davis just days after she turned 100 on Wednesday, May 10, and just a few miles from where she was born in Roque Bluffs. 

Davis has lived in the Kennebec district of Machias for 75 years, in the same house she and her husband Millard refurbished not long after they were married at the Roque Bluffs Baptist Church.
